PRF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

487 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co FTSE RAFI US 1000 ETF (PRF)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$5.13B — up 9.7% from $4.68B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 40 funds opened new PRF posit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 148 added to existing stakes and 130 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Kovitz Investment Group Partners, adding an estimated $52.7M. The largest seller was Focus Partners Wealth, cutting an estimated $9.44M.
